Fly-casting is a skill of almost mythic proportions. The gymnastic beauty of the casting scenes in the film A River Runs Through It sent thousands of new anglers to the shores of America's streams and lakes. Yet more often than not, discussions or instructions about casting bog down in a world of technical minutiae that is almost impenetrable to the beginner. Mel Krieger has cracked the code in The Essence of Flycasting. Through detailed instructions and dozens of precise photographs and diagrams, he clearly dissects this arcane art into understandable and executable steps to take the raw beginner from piles of line on the ground to graceful loops in the air. And the seasoned veteran will advance from struggling with 30-foot casts to skillfully double-hauling vastly more line across the water. This is the first full-scale monograph of the life and work of the remarkable British artist Merlyn Evans (1910–73). Deeply affected by the poverty and violence that he witnessed in Glasgow during the depressed years of the late 1920s and early 1930s, Evans developed a highly personal abstract style, combining plant, crustacean and mechanical forms. His work was fundamentally shaped by his conviction that art should be an engagement with life, reflecting psychological, ethical and political concerns. Surrealism became a major influence, but Evans’s subject matter became increasingly social and political, reflecting his growing concern over economic distress at home and political disaster in Europe. Living in South Africa at the end of the 1930s, he remained preoccupied by the European crisis, and his paintings made explicit reference to economic depression, atrocity and war. In London afterWorldWar II, he took up etching and aquatint and embarked on a distinguished printmaking career in parallel to his painting. He was deeply read in psychology, philosophy, politics, mechanics, optics, and the history and techniques of art, as well as in modernist literature and contemporary poetry. All these aspects of his thought found expression in his work as an artist and as a writer and teacher.

It is virtually impossible to discuss modern acting or actor training without first mentioning the Russian thoerist and director Konstantin Stanislavsky. Complete in one volume Mel Gordon explores the actor training systems of Stanislavsky and his two most important disciples Evgeni Vakhtangov and Michael Chekhov tracing the major teachings and refinements over the first 50 years of use by actors. Gordon reconstructs the Êactual exercisesÊ taught at the Moscow Art Theatre and various Russian acting studios and he clears away the myths and confusion about the practical use of Stanislavsky's System. This volume contains: The Stanislavsky System ä First Studio Exercises 1912-1916; Vakhtangov as Rebel and Theoretician ä Exercises 1919-1921; Michael Chekhov ä Exercises 1919-1952; and Stanislavsky's Fourth Period ä Theory of Physical Actions 1934-1938.

Sylvia Edwards, when describing her technique for beginning a new abstract watercolour, begins with the application of colour which seems to start the whole mystical process of what will eventually become a satisfactory image. ‘I carefully place on a fresh palette as many colours as can possibly fit, rather than selecting a limited palette. The full range of colours is more of a challenge, especially with watercolours. Colours are like a celestial banquet. The more vivid and varied they are, the happier I am.’ Sylvia Edwards’s work has achieved huge commercial success and is known, and respected, around the world. She has had over 30 solo exhibitions in America, Europe, the Far and Middle East since her first commercial, one-woman exhibition, at the Iran American Society in Tehran in 1975. Nearly 50 group exhibitions have included her work since her first group show, in 1962 at Abadan, in Iran. Her reproductions on unicef greetings cards are amongst the most popular and sell in their millions. Her poster prints for highly succesful art publishers such as the Art Group (London) and Bruce McGaw Graphics (New York) were amongst the top-selling images in their respective ranges. Yet Sylvia Edwards has chosen to work within that most difficult of artistic genres – the abstract. An ability to satisfy the toughest aesthetic critique alongside success within the extraordinarily competitive ­– and largely non-abstract – commercial art world is rare, and especially so for a woman.
